PSG vs Liverpool LIVE score, UCL 2025-26: Real-time updates from Champions League quarterfinal first leg

Welcome to Sportstar’s live coverage of the PSG vs Liverpool UCL 2025-26 quarterfinal first leg match being played at the Parc des Princes.

LINEUPS

PSG: Safonov (gk), Hakimi, Marquinhos, Pacho, Mendes, Zaire-Emery, Vitinha, Neves, Doue, Dembele, Kvaratskhelia

Liverpool: Mamardashvili (gk), Gomez, Konate, Van Dijk, Kerkez, Gravenberch, Mac Allister, Frimpong, Szoboszlai, Wirtz, Ekitike

LIVE UPDATES

LIVESTREAM AND TELECAST INFO

When and where will PSG vs Liverpool be played?

PSG vs Liverpool in the UEFA Champions League 2025-26 quarterfinals will be played at the Parc des Princes in France. The match is scheduled to kick off on April 8 at 9 pm local time (12:30 am IST, April 9).

How to watch PSG vs Liverpool in the UEFA Champions League?

PSG vs Liverpool in the UEFA Champions League can be watched on the Sony Sports Network on TV in India. Moreover, it can also be live-streamed on Sony LIV.

In the UK, fans can watch the game on TNT Sports on TV. It can also be live-streamed on the HBO Max app and website, on a subscriber-only basis.

In the USA, PSG vs Liverpool can be watched on Paramount+.

The Democratic Republic of Congo warmed up for ​their first World Cup appearance in more ‌than half a century with a ​0-0 draw against Denmark on ⁠Wednesday.

The clash in Belgium, where the Congolese have been preparing for the World Cup, could ‌be their only preparatory match after a planned friendly against Chile ‌in Spain on Monday was ‌cancelled ⁠by local authorities.

The mayor of La ⁠Linea de la Concepcion took the decision even though the Congolese team have been preparing ​for the tournament in ‌Belgium and almost all of their players and staff are based in Europe.

Denmark, which narrowly missed out on ‌World Cup qualification after a penalty ​shootout loss to the Czech Republic in the European playoffs in ⁠March, twice hit the woodwork with Joakim Maehle striking the post with a ‌curling shot in the 33rd minute and captain Pierre-Emile Hojbjerg catching the corner of the crossbar with a long-range effort early in the second half.

Congolese striker Cedric Bakambu had a chance ‌on the break in the 24th minute but ​he hit his effort straight at Denmark goalkeeper Filip Jorgensen, who ⁠made another sharp save to deny Joris ⁠Kayembe with the last shot of the match.

At the World Cup, ‌DR Congo opens its Group K campaign against Portugal on June 17.

DR Congo vs Denmark player ratings:

DR Congo: Dimitry Bertaud (7.5/10), Gédéon Kalulu (6.9/10), Chancel Mbemba (7.4/10), Henoc Inonga (7.1/10), Arthur Masuaku (7.0/10), Charles Pickel (6.7/10), Samuel Moutoussamy (6.8/10), Théo Bongonda (6.5/10), Gaël Kakuta (6.6/10), Yoane Wissa (6.9/10), Cédric Bakambu (6.3/10)

Subs: Joris Kayembe (6.4/10), Meschak Elia (6.1/10), Fiston Mayele (5.9/10), Noah Sadiki (6.0/10)

Denmark: Filip Jörgensen (7.4/10), Alexander Bah (7.1/10), Joachim Andersen (7.3/10), Jannik Vestergaard (7.2/10), Joakim Mæhle (7.6/10), Pierre-Emile Højbjerg (7.8/10), Morten Hjulmand (6.9/10), Christian Eriksen (7.0/10), Adam Daghim (6.5/10), Rasmus Højlund (6.2/10), Jonas Wind (6.6/10)

Subs: Gustav Isaksen (6.2/10), Morten Frendrup (6.0/10), Victor Kristiansen (6.1/10), Yussuf Poulsen (5.9/10)
